Code P1631 2013 Toyota RAV4 Description
The diagnostic trouble code P1631 in a 2013 Toyota RAV4 indicates a communication error between the Engine Control Module (ECM) and the Vehicle Stability Control (VSC) system. The ECM is responsible for monitoring and controlling various engine functions, such as fuel injection, ignition timing, and emissions control. On the other hand, the VSC system is designed to assist in maintaining vehicle stability and prevent skidding during sudden maneuvers.
Common Causes of P1631 2013 Toyota RAV4
- Faulty Wiring: Damaged or corroded wiring connections between the ECM and VSC can disrupt communication signals.
- Sensor Malfunction: A malfunctioning sensor within the VSC system or ECM can trigger the P1631 code.
- Module Failure: A faulty ECM or VSC module can prevent proper communication between the two systems.
- Electrical Interference: External factors such as electromagnetic interference or poor grounding can interfere with communication signals.
- Moisture Intrusion: Water intrusion into the wiring harness or module connectors can lead to communication errors between the ECM and VSC.
Symptoms of P1631 2013 Toyota RAV4
- Check Engine Light: The most common symptom associated with the P1631 code is the illumination of the check engine light on the dashboard.
- Reduced Engine Performance: The vehicle may experience a decrease in power or acceleration due to the communication error between the ECM and VSC.
- Stability Control Warning Light: The VSC warning light may also illuminate, indicating a problem with the stability control system.
- Rough Idle: The engine may idle roughly or inconsistently, resulting from the lack of proper communication between the ECM and VSC.
- Increased Fuel Consumption: A communication error between the ECM and VSC can lead to inefficient engine operation, causing higher fuel consumption.
How to Fix P1631 2013 Toyota RAV4
- Diagnose the Issue: Use a diagnostic scan tool to retrieve the trouble codes and perform a thorough inspection of the wiring, connectors, sensors, and modules related to the ECM and VSC.
- Repair Wiring Connections: Repair or replace any damaged or corroded wiring connections between the ECM and VSC.
- Replace Faulty Sensors: If a sensor within the VSC system or ECM is found to be malfunctioning, replace it with a new one.
- Test Modules: Test the ECM and VSC modules for proper functionality and replace any faulty components if necessary.
- Clear Codes and Test Drive: After completing the repairs, clear the trouble codes from the ECM memory and test drive the vehicle to ensure that the communication error has been resolved.
Cost to Fix P1631 2013 Toyota RAV4
The typical repair costs for addressing a communication error between the ECM and VSC in a 2013 Toyota RAV4 can range from $200 to $600, including parts and labor. However, the specific diagnosis time and labor rates at auto repair shops can vary significantly based on factors such as location, vehicle make and model, and engine type. It is essential to check local rates for a more accurate estimate. Most auto repair shops charge between $80 and $150 per hour for labor, but rates may be higher at dealerships or in metropolitan areas, while independent shops often offer lower rates.
